In a year-long study of liver cancer patients in China, researchers discovered that something as ordinary as a lit bedroom at night may quietly deepen the body's struggle against disease. Patients whose sleeping spaces exceeded 50 lux of nighttime light faced measurably higher risks of hepatic encephalopathy, impaired liver function, and death — suggesting that the boundary between environment and illness is more porous than medicine has traditionally acknowledged.
